Market Potential of Synthetic Leather & New Materials in Bangladesh: How Bangladesh Leather & Footwear Expo Supports Industry Networking
Bangladesh’s leather and footwear industry is undergoing a major transformation driven by innovation, sustainability, and changing global consumer demand. As international markets increasingly prefer eco-friendly, cost-effective, and durable alternatives, the demand for synthetic leather and advanced footwear materials is growing rapidly. This shift is creating significant business opportunities for manufacturers, exporters, suppliers, and investors in Bangladesh.
Today, materials such as PU leather, vegan leather, microfiber materials, recycled fabrics, and sustainable synthetic components are becoming increasingly popular in the global footwear and fashion industries. International brands are actively searching for environmentally responsible sourcing solutions, encouraging Bangladeshi manufacturers to adopt modern materials and advanced production technologies.
The use of synthetic leather and innovative materials in Bangladesh is helping manufacturers reduce production costs, improve product variety, and increase manufacturing efficiency. These materials are widely used in sports footwear, fashion shoes, leather goods, bags, belts, and lifestyle accessories. As a result, Bangladesh is strengthening its position as a competitive sourcing destination in the international footwear and leather market.
